Amlodipine Besylate Tablets USP 5 mg
Amlodipine is a calcium channel blocker used to lower blood pressure and treat certain types of chest pain (angina). It is available as a 5mg tablet for oral use.
What it is
Amlodipine belongs to a class of medicines known as calcium channel blockers. It works by relaxing blood vessels, which helps lower blood pressure and improve blood flow.
What it's used for
Amlodipine is used to treat high blood pressure (hypertension) in adults and children aged 6 years and older. Lowering blood pressure reduces the risk of strokes and heart attacks. It is also used to treat chronic stable angina, vasospastic angina (Prinzmetal's angina), and angiographically documented coronary artery disease in patients without heart failure or low ejection fraction.
Common side effects
The most common side effects are swelling of the ankles or feet (edema), dizziness, flushing, palpitations (feeling of rapid or forceful heartbeat), fatigue, and nausea. These tend to occur more often with higher doses.
Important cautions
Do not take amlodipine if you are allergic to it. Use with caution if you have severe narrowing of the aortic heart valve (aortic stenosis), as it may cause low blood pressure. Rarely, worsening chest pain or heart attack has occurred after starting or increasing the dose, especially in people with severe coronary artery disease. Patients with severe liver disease should have their dose increased slowly. Speak to your doctor before taking this medicine if you have any of these conditions.

How is amlodipine taken?
Amlodipine is taken by mouth once daily. The usual starting dose for adults is 5mg, and it can be increased to 10mg. Always take it exactly as prescribed by your doctor.
